    Dwayne says "you get what you pay for" and he is dead right! We commit 38% LESS to our athletic program spending than the next LOWEST in the WAC, Nevada, and 150% less than Fresno State at the top of the WAC. That translates to almost $3 million LESS than the next LOWEST, Nevada, and $11.5 million LESS than Fresno State at the top. "You get what you pay for," RIGHT?
